I am finding that with NS6, if it happens to be run as root, then it can remove the entire /tmp directory from my machine (RH7.0) when attempting to "clean up" after itself. I have to manually recreate it before anything else (including X) can run! Has anyone else seen this or is no-one else stupid enough to run it as root?
